Getting the kace agent executable or msi

Hi guys,

How do I get the kace agent msi or exe.

All I seem to be able to download from the

dell support is the Kbin file.

Anyway I can extract an executable from the Kbin.

Thanks folks.

You can get the MSI for the agent from the client share on your appliance, e.g. \\k1000\client\. Browse to the agent provisioning folder to get the agent for the OS required. 

The kbin file from support is used to update the appliance with the latest version of the client.

no, you need to upload it to the KACE appliance.
The upload itself does not mean that it will be deployed to any system.
You can also go to Settings > Provsioning > Agent Update, where you also upload the agent bundle, and click to the agent you need.
If the agent is already deployed to a machine you should use this feature to let the KACE update the agent by checking Activated and All Devices.
